Louis Riel and Reconciling the History of the North-West Resistance
Each year on November 16, Métis commemorate the wrongful execution of Louis Riel in 1885. Most Canadians however, don't know the truth about what happened in 1885, or its enduring legacy.
Keith Henry, BC Metis Federation President, will present an overview of what actually happened in Batoche and a personal perspective on its intergenerational impacts.
